Bonjour,

voil� j'ai une page o� on peut ajouter des TR, et o� on doit pouvoir les supprimer.
je n'arrive pas � les supprimer en essayant que le JS soit compatible au niveau de IE et FF au moins.
Je fais par exemple :
Code : S�lectionner tout - Visualiser dans une fen�tre � part
1
2
var element=document.getElementsByTagName("TR")[0];
    document.documentElement.removeChild(element);
sous IE �a me met comme erreur "argument non valide", sous FF j'ignore comment je peux savoir l'erreur que �a remonte
En plus il faut permettre de supprimer le TR courant, donc j'utilise la fonction :
Code : S�lectionner tout - Visualiser dans une fen�tre � part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
function whichElement(e){
var targ;
if (!e){
  var e = window.event;
  }
if (e.target){
  targ = e.target;
  }
else if (e.srcElement){
  targ = e.srcElement;
  }
 
var tname;
tname=targ.tagName;
et pour supprimer l'�l�ment selectionn�, j'essaie ceci :
Code : S�lectionner tout - Visualiser dans une fen�tre � part
targ.parentElement.removeChild(targ);
au niveau IE �a marche, mais au niveau FF �a plante